Home
last modified time | relevance | path

Searched full:spdif_clk (Results 1 – 18 of 18) sorted by relevance

/linux/drivers/clk/qcom/
H A Dlcc-ipq806x.c344 static struct clk_branch spdif_clk = { variable
352 .name = "spdif_clk",
411 [SPDIF_CLK] = &spdif_clk.clkr,
/linux/include/dt-bindings/clock/
H A Dqcom,lcc-ipq806x.h19 #define SPDIF_CLK 10 macro
/linux/drivers/gpu/drm/meson/
H A Dmeson_dw_hdmi.h36 * Bit 10 RW spdif_clk_inv: 1=Invert spdif_clk; 0=No invert. Default 0.
44 * Bit 2 RW spdif_clk_en: 1=enable spdif_clk; 0=disable. Default 0.
/linux/Documentation/devicetree/bindings/sound/
H A Dallwinner,sun4i-a10-spdif.yaml120 clocks = <&apb0_gates 1>, <&spdif_clk>;
/linux/drivers/clk/actions/
H A Dowl-s500.c391 static OWL_COMP_DIV(spdif_clk, "spdif_clk", i2s_clk_mux_p,
459 &spdif_clk.common,
520 [CLK_SPDIF] = &spdif_clk.common.hw,
/linux/drivers/clk/sunxi-ng/
H A Dccu-suniv-f1c100s.c239 static SUNXI_CCU_MUX_WITH_GATE(spdif_clk, "spdif", i2s_spdif_parents,
364 &spdif_clk.common,
456 [CLK_SPDIF] = &spdif_clk.common.hw,
H A Dccu-sun8i-h3.c417 static SUNXI_CCU_M_WITH_GATE(spdif_clk, "spdif", "pll-audio",
591 &spdif_clk.common,
731 [CLK_SPDIF] = &spdif_clk.common.hw,
847 [CLK_SPDIF] = &spdif_clk.common.hw,
H A Dccu-sun8i-a83t.c467 static SUNXI_CCU_M_WITH_GATE(spdif_clk, "spdif", "pll-audio",
666 &spdif_clk.common,
771 [CLK_SPDIF] = &spdif_clk.common.hw,
H A Dccu-sun50i-a64.c503 static SUNXI_CCU_M_WITH_GATE(spdif_clk, "spdif", "pll-audio",
713 &spdif_clk.common,
829 [CLK_SPDIF] = &spdif_clk.common.hw,
H A Dccu-sun4i-a10.c602 static SUNXI_CCU_MUX_WITH_GATE(spdif_clk, "spdif", audio_parents,
979 &spdif_clk.common,
1164 [CLK_SPDIF] = &spdif_clk.common.hw,
1330 [CLK_SPDIF] = &spdif_clk.common.hw,
H A Dccu-sun5i.c404 static SUNXI_CCU_MUX_WITH_GATE(spdif_clk, "spdif", spdif_parents,
577 &spdif_clk.common,
948 [CLK_SPDIF] = &spdif_clk.common.hw,
H A Dccu-sun50i-h6.c565 static struct ccu_div spdif_clk = { variable
894 &spdif_clk.common,
1035 [CLK_SPDIF] = &spdif_clk.common.hw,
H A Dccu-sun9i-a80.c537 static SUNXI_CCU_M_WITH_GATE(spdif_clk, "spdif", "pll-audio",
879 &spdif_clk.common,
1025 [CLK_SPDIF] = &spdif_clk.common.hw,
H A Dccu-sun50i-a100.c584 static struct ccu_div spdif_clk = { variable
895 &spdif_clk.common,
1029 [CLK_SPDIF] = &spdif_clk.common.hw,
H A Dccu-sun50i-h616.c514 static struct ccu_div spdif_clk = { variable
846 &spdif_clk.common,
984 [CLK_SPDIF] = &spdif_clk.common.hw,
H A Dccu-sun6i-a31.c477 static SUNXI_CCU_MUX_WITH_GATE(spdif_clk, "spdif", daudio_parents,
899 &spdif_clk.common,
1087 [CLK_SPDIF] = &spdif_clk.common.hw,
/linux/drivers/gpu/drm/rockchip/
H A Dcdn-dp-core.c707 dp->spdif_clk = devm_clk_get(dev, "spdif"); in cdn_dp_parse_dt()
708 if (IS_ERR(dp->spdif_clk)) { in cdn_dp_parse_dt()
709 DRM_DEV_ERROR(dev, "cannot get spdif_clk\n"); in cdn_dp_parse_dt()
710 return PTR_ERR(dp->spdif_clk); in cdn_dp_parse_dt()
H A Dcdn-dp-reg.c812 clk_disable_unprepare(dp->spdif_clk); in cdn_dp_audio_stop()
927 clk_prepare_enable(dp->spdif_clk); in cdn_dp_audio_config_spdif()
928 clk_set_rate(dp->spdif_clk, CDN_DP_SPDIF_CLK); in cdn_dp_audio_config_spdif()